4 first past the post
ⓘ First past the post system Les élections législatives britanniques ne comportant qu'un seul tour, c'est le candidat qui remporte le plus de suffrages (sans obtenir nécessairement 50% des voix) qui est élu député. Ce système encourage donc le vote ‘utile’ qui favorise les deux grands partis, travaillistes ( Labour) et conservateurs ( Conservative). Les libéraux-démocrates ( Liberal Democrats), avec une moyenne de 25% des voix, n'obtiennent que 3 ou 4% des sièges à la Chambre des communes. ⇒ House of Commons
